Location: Remote (New York City) or Hybrid (McLean, VA).
As a Manager on Hilton's Americas Marketing team, you will collaborate with revenue management, sales, and analytics to drive profitable growth. In our newly launched in‑house marketing agency, you will lead multi‑channel campaigns to deliver commercial performance.

How You Will Make An Impact What Your Day‑to‑day Will Be Like
Strategic Partner to Hotels in High‑Revenue Markets: serve as an account manager for a portfolio of hotels in key markets, acting as the primary marketing advisor and crafting tailored paid‑media strategies.
Campaign Strategy, Execution, and Optimization: provide budget and investment recommendations, translate commercial performance data from analytics platforms into actionable insights, and lead the strategy of multi‑channel marketing campaigns—including paid search, paid social, metasearch, and more.
Data Analysis: analyze commercial performance data via analysis tools and present storytelling performance insights to hotels and senior leadership.
How You Will Collaborate With Others
Meet with hotels in your assigned portfolio and communicate campaign performance, risks, and opportunities.
Act as the central liaison between the hotel, agency partners, and Enterprise partner teams.
As the program evolves, take on direct‑line people leadership roles.
What Projects You Will Take Ownership Of
Program Innovation & Advocacy: understand hotel needs and identify opportunities for program evolution.
Testing & Growth: lead proactive media testing opportunities.
You Have These Minimum Qualifications
Five (5) years of professional work experience.
Expertise in Meta and Google Ads, including campaign strategy and optimization across Search, Display, and Video, with a strong understanding of audience targeting, bidding strategies, and performance measurement.
Willingness to travel up to 20%.
It Would Be Useful If You Have
Bachelor's degree in marketing, advertising, or a related field.
Experience working within Salesforce and Adobe Analytics.
Professional certifications from Google and Meta.
Experience analyzing data and using data analysis tools to guide strategic decisions.
People leadership and mentoring experience.
Marketing or media agency background, including hands‑on account management experience.
Located remotely in the NYC area or hybrid‑based in McLean, VA.
